1. Kwangdong Pharmaceutical H1 2025 Earnings: What Happened?

Kwangdong Pharmaceutical achieved revenue of KRW 425.2 billion in H1 2025, continuing its growth trend. However, operating profit and net profit declined to KRW 4.5 billion and KRW 2.3 billion, respectively, indicating a decline in profitability.

2. Why These Results?: Key Factor Analysis

Revenue growth was driven by strong performance in the F&B sector (Samdasoo, Vita500) and ethical pharmaceuticals. However, increased selling, general and administrative expenses, and R&D expenses negatively impacted profitability. New business ventures (solar power generation) and investments in new drug development are positive in the long term.
